WOMEN'S BASKETBALL STAYS AT NO. 4 IN NATIONAL POLL
LILBURN, Ga. — Michigan Tech remained at No. 4 in this week's USA TODAY/ESPN Women's Basketball Division II Coaches' Poll. The Huskies have been ranked No. 4 for three straight weeks and in the nation's top five all season.

STREAM AND WYSOCKY NAMED ACADEMIC ALL-DISTRICT FIRST TEAM
HOUGHTON, Mich. — Michigan Tech women's basketball seniors Sarah Stream (Ishpeming, Mich./Westwood) and Katie Wysocky (Whitefish Bay, Wis.) recently earned ESPN the Magazine Academic All-District accolades. The pair were both chosen to the College Division's District IV First Team, making them eligible for Academic All-America status.

MEN'S TENNIS OPENS 2010 WITH PAIR OF 9-0 WINS
RIPON, Wis. — Michigan Tech opened its 2010 men's tennis season with a pair of 9-0 victories today. The Huskies swept both Lakeland and host Ripon to start its regular season.

TECH TAKES WINTER CARNIVAL TITLE; KATTELUS NAMED MVP
Michigan Tech dropped a 3-2 decision to No. 6 Minnesota Duluth Saturday (Feb. 6) but earned its first Winter Carnival title since 2007 thanks to a 5-4 advantage in total goals on the weekend. Junior forward Eric Kattelus was named Winter Carnival MVP after finishing with one goal and three assists in the series.
